Understanding Food Acidity and Alkalinity
Foods can be classified based on their pH level. Acidic foods typically have a pH below 7 and include ingredients like tomatoes, citrus fruits, and vinegar. Alkaline foods have a pH above 7 and include leafy greens, nuts, and certain vegetables. The acidity or alkalinity of food can affect how it interacts with cookware, potentially causing corrosion or leaching of materials.
Cookware Materials and Their Suitability
Cast Iron and Enameled Cast Iron
Cast iron cookware is durable and excellent for many cooking tasks. Enameled cast iron is coated with a glass-like layer that prevents rusting and is suitable for acidic foods, as it doesn’t react with them. However, uncoated cast iron can react with acidic ingredients, causing a metallic taste and damaging the seasoning.
Stainless Steel
Stainless steel is a versatile and non-reactive material, making it ideal for cooking both acidic and alkaline foods. It resists corrosion and does not leach harmful substances into food, ensuring safety and flavor integrity.
Copper
Copper cookware offers excellent heat conduction but is highly reactive with acidic foods. When cooking acidic ingredients in copper, it is recommended to use lined copper pots to prevent reactions that can alter the taste and color of your food.
Practical Tips for Selecting Cookware
- Use enameled cast iron or stainless steel for acidic foods.
- Avoid unlined copper and uncoated cast iron with acidic ingredients.
- Choose stainless steel for versatility and safety.
- Consider the type of food and cooking method when selecting cookware.
- Regularly inspect cookware for signs of corrosion or damage.
